首字下沉是一種在排版中常用的技巧,它可以讓文章的段落更加醒目、易讀,在CSS中,我們可以使用text-indent
屬性來實(shí)現(xiàn)首字下沉的效果,下面是一些具體的步驟和代碼示例。
1、確定需要首字下沉的段落,你可以通過CSS選擇器來選擇這些段落。
2、使用text-indent
屬性來設(shè)置首字的下沉距離,這個屬性的值可以是像素、em、rem等單位。
3、如果需要,你還可以使用text-decoration
屬性來給首字添加一些裝飾,比如顏色、背景等。
下面是一個具體的代碼示例:
p { text-indent: 2em; /* 首字下沉2em */ text-decoration: color red; /* 首字顏色為紅色 */ }
在這個示例中,所有段落(p
元素)的首字都會下沉2em,并且首字的顏色會被設(shè)置為紅色,你可以根據(jù)自己的需要來調(diào)整這些值。
需要注意的是,text-indent
屬性只對塊級元素有效,如果你需要對行內(nèi)元素(如span
)進(jìn)行首字下沉,可能需要使用其他方法來實(shí)現(xiàn)。text-decoration
屬性的效果可能會受到其他樣式的影響,比如字體大小、顏色等,所以可能需要綜合考慮來得到理想的效果。